diff options
Diffstat (limited to 'tests/pipeline')
| -rw-r--r-- | tests/pipeline/ray-tracing/trace-ray-inline.slang.glsl | 14 |
1 files changed, 3 insertions, 11 deletions
diff --git a/tests/pipeline/ray-tracing/trace-ray-inline.slang.glsl b/tests/pipeline/ray-tracing/trace-ray-inline.slang.glsl index f9e94bb30..389dae05a 100644 --- a/tests/pipeline/ray-tracing/trace-ray-inline.slang.glsl +++ b/tests/pipeline/ray-tracing/trace-ray-inline.slang.glsl @@ -106,14 +106,10 @@ void main() tHit_1 = 0.00000000000000000000; bool _S6 = myProceduralIntersection_0(tHit_1, candidateProceduralAttrs_0); - MyProceduralHitAttrs_0 committedProceduralAttrs_2; - if(_S6) { bool _S7 = myProceduralAnyHit_0(payload_5); - MyProceduralHitAttrs_0 committedProceduralAttrs_3; - if(_S7) { rayQueryGenerateIntersectionEXT(query_0, tHit_1); @@ -126,28 +122,24 @@ void main() { } - committedProceduralAttrs_3 = _S8; + committedProceduralAttrs_1 = _S8; } else { - committedProceduralAttrs_3 = committedProceduralAttrs_0; + committedProceduralAttrs_1 = committedProceduralAttrs_0; } - committedProceduralAttrs_2 = committedProceduralAttrs_3; - } else { - committedProceduralAttrs_2 = committedProceduralAttrs_0; + committedProceduralAttrs_1 = committedProceduralAttrs_0; } - committedProceduralAttrs_1 = committedProceduralAttrs_2; - break; } case 0U: |
